ACPICA: Fix for namespace lookup problem
Fixed a problem where objects of certain types (Device, ThermalZone, Processor, PowerResource) can be not found if they are declared and referenced from within the same control method http://www.acpica.org/bugzilla/show_bug.cgi?id=341.
